(Washington, D.C.) Pentagon lawyers have put a former Navy seal on alert that he could soon face legal action for writing a book about the raid that killed Osama Bin Laden.
Mark Owen, a pen name used by the Navy Seal, wrote the book entitled “No Easy Day.”
Lawyers say the Seal violated an agreement he made not to tell military secrets, and he never gave a manuscript to the Pentagon to be reviewed.
The book is set to be published next week.
